HYDERABAD: TRS president and Chief Minister K.

Chandrashekar Rao has actually firmed up his choice to field a regional prospect from Backward Classes, coming from the Yadava community, for the approaching byelection to the Nagarjunasagar Assembly constituency, according to TRS sources.Rao is learnt to have actually taken this decision ostensibly not to rely on any 'sympathy element', which stopped working to operate in the Dubbak Assembly by-election last December.

This implies that Nomula Bharat, boy of Nagarjunasagar MLA Nomula Narasimhaiah, will not get the ticket as was extensively speculated earlier as Bharath comes from Palem village of Nakrekal Mandal in Nalgonda district.

Narasimhaiah's death has demanded the by-poll.

Chandrashekar Rao apparently ensured Bharat of a chosen post soon.The Chief Minister is learnt to have actually considered three local candidates from the Yadava neighborhood: Peddaboyina Srinivas Yadav (Tripuraram mandal), Mannem Ranjith Yadav and Katteboyina Guravaiah Yadav (Nidamanuru mandal).

Based on multiple survey reports, he has zeroed in on Guravaiah Yadav, son-in-law of former MLA Rammurthy Yadav and a close relative of the party's Rajya Sabha member Badugula Lingaiah Yadav.An official statement on Guravaiah's candidature is likely to be made immediately after the Election Commission reveals the schedule for the bypoll.The TRS chief offered a ticket to Solipeta Sujatha, widow of Solipeta Ramalinga Reddy in Dubbak, depending on the 'compassion element'.

The BJP defeated the TRS by projecting itself as the primary opposition to the TRS in the state.

In this background, Rao is being extra careful in the selection of the Nagarjunasagar prospect where the Congress has decided to field its strongman K.

Jana Reddy, who has won 7 times from this seat however lost to Narasimhaiah in 2018.

Rao commissioned multiple surveys with different agencies to get a feel of the pulse of the citizens.

TRS sources say that all the survey reports suggested that a lot of voters preferred a 'local' prospect from the Yadava community which has a major chunk of voters in the Nagarjunasagar segment.The studies explained that the neighborhood had actually sacrificed the seat to Narasimhaiah, a non-local, in the 2018 Assembly elections appreciating his large political profession and his 'pro-poor attitude' but they are not eager to support his child Bharat, a political newbie.

In spite of the fact that TRS leaders from Reddy neighborhood like Gutta Sukhender Reddy, Tera Chinnapa Reddy, Koti Reddy are vying for the party ticket, Chandrashekar Rao is found out to have favoured a Yadav prospect.
